Transaction 76f52faa60655265fc46b3e75bc7e5f94819fa5d24fabe80df81ff0ba1aaa982
1 Input
1 Output
-
76f52faa60655265fc46b3e75bc7e5f94819fa5d24fabe80df81ff0ba1aaa982:0
- value
- 16639
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ce9c9075122e6e579634a070bbd2fae8994406eb
- address
- bc1qe6wfqagj9eh909355pcth5h6azv5gpht0a8nd9